Subject: Key rotation for Crashwick pipeline

Hi reviewers — we're rotating the ingestion credential for the Crashwick mobile crash-report pipeline on Friday. The old key stops working at cutover, so please verify the config change in the Ostermill repo references the new one. For verification during review, the replacement key appears below.

service key, tadup-tahog: zpat7_wB1tnEL

Handover: consent banner rollout (Brindlewick UI). Feature flag `cb_v2` at 40%, ramping daily. Geo rules live for the Veldmark region only; others default to implicit. Reviewer: check the opt-out persistence fix in PR 14 — cookie scope was wrong. Rollback script is in the deploy repo. The staging vault needs the recovery passphrase below.

unlock words, yawig-kagef: gordor-holvan-ulaael-pramir-ulaiel-tamdor

## Break-Glass: FareForge Rules Engine

FareForge computes shipping fees for all Brindlecart storefronts. If the rules engine admin console locks out during an incident, use the break-glass path. Don't guess rule syntax under pressure; escalate to the Pricing Guild channel first.

Steps: confirm the outage in the Fee Audit dashboard, page the duty lead, then open the sealed recovery flow from the ops bastion. Log every action. Contractors must have a staff sponsor present.

The sealed flow requires the recovery passphrase below.

unlock words, hahip-baduf: holwyn-istath-julvan